Description
A educação, enquanto conceito e condição fundamentais à
transformação do homem nas suas múlplas dimensões, encontra nos
seus recursos e contextos de referência um universo potencial que,
projetando a escola para além da sua vocação meramente
academizante, a legitima enquanto entidade promotora de uma
pedagogia cultural. O design e a arquitetura, enquanto áreas
concomitantes da própria realidade escolar, vêm afirmando novas formas
de expressão estética e funcional e inaugurando novas perspetivas
didáticas decorrentes da fusão entre utilizador, contexto e objeto -
aspetos essenciais à redefinição do gosto e ao dever de parcipação cívica
do indivíduo no quadro da (re)invenção e humanização dos espaços e
objetos de usufruição comuns. No pressuposto das ideias expressas, vimos
situar factos e refletir sobre a possibilidade da escola se declarar como
centro de conhecimento, cultura e lazer com preocupações ecológicas,
estéticas e cívicas, e na qual o design e a arquitetura se afirmem como
currículo oculto – participando assim nesse desígnio integrador de
ensinar, educar e formar.
ABSTRACT: Education, as a fundamental concept and state for the transformation of man in its multiple dimensions, finds a potential universe in its resources and contexts of reference that, projecting the school besides its role merely academic, legimate the education as a promoter entity of a cultural pedagogy. Design and architecture, as concomitant areas of school reality, have been asserting new ways of aesthetic and functional expression and opening new didactic insights resulting from the fusion between operator, context, and object - main features to the preference redefinition and to the duty of civic participation in a framework of spaces and objects´ (re)invention and humanization commonly used. On the assumption of the views expressed, we come to establish facts and reflect on the possibility of school to affirm itself as a center of knowledge, culture, and leisure with ecological, aesthetic, and civic concerns, in which design and architecture have established themselves as an unknown curriculum – and thereby they have participated in this integrate purpose of teaching and educating.
